Excel-Zeilen und -Spalten wiederholen

Wenn sich Excel-Tabellen über mehrere Seiten erstrecken, sind die Daten einfacher und schneller zu lesen, wenn wir die Spalten- oder Zeilentitel rechts oder oben auf jeder Seite drucken(wiederholung). Diese werden in Excel Wiederholungszeilen und -spalten oder Kopfzeilen und -spalten genannt. IronXL kann diesen nützlichen Aspekt der Tabellenkalkulation mit nur wenigen Zeilen Code nutzen.

SetRepeatingRows(startRow, endRow)

Diese Methode wird verwendet, um sich wiederholende Zeilen zu setzen. Zum Beispiel: workSheet.SetRepeatingRows(3, 4) setzt Wiederholungen auf Reihe(4-5).

SetRepeatingColumns(startColumn, endColumn)

Diese Methode wird verwendet, um sich wiederholende Spalten zu setzen. Zum Beispiel: workSheet.SetRepeatingColumns(0, 2)wird die Wiederholung auf "Spalte" gesetzt(A-C).

Diese beiden Methoden verwenden nullbasierte Indizierung als Parameter, so dass die Spalte(0) ist "A" und Zeile(1) ist 2. Bitte beachten Sie auch, dass diese Methoden, wenn sie wie im obigen Codebeispiel kombiniert verwendet werden.

Auf Inhalte, die sich über mehrere Seiten erstrecken, wird nur die Regel der sich wiederholenden Spalten auf der rechten Seite der ersten Seite angewendet. Abbildung 1 zeigt das Phänomen:

Abbildung 1

Abbildung 1

Mehrere Seiten, die sich über die Unterseite der ersten Seite erstrecken, enthalten Wiederholungszeilen.

Schließlich werden auf Seiten, die sich auf der Innenseite befinden, sowohl die Wiederholungsspalten- als auch die Wiederholungszeilenregel angewendet. Abbildung 2 zeigt die letzten beiden Phänomene:

Abbildung 2

Abbildung 2